Georgia SB 296 (2013_14) — State Park Authority; revise the powers and responsibilities

A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Part 1 of Article 7 of Chapter 3 of Title 12 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to the Jekyll Island—State Park Authority, so as to revise the powers and responsibilities of the authority; to define terms; to revise the components of the master plan; to clarify development powers and restrictions for the authority;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2014-01-17 Senate Hopper
  • 2014-01-21 Senate Read and Referred referral-committee
  • 2014-01-24 Senate Committee Favorably Reported committee-passage-favorable
  • 2014-01-27 Senate Read Second Time reading-2
  • 2014-02-03 Senate Third Read reading-3
  • 2014-02-03 Senate Passed/Adopted passage
  • 2014-02-04 House First Readers reading-1
  • 2014-02-05 House Second Readers reading-2
  • 2014-03-06 House Committee Favorably Reported committee-passage-favorable
  • 2014-03-11 House Third Readers reading-3
  • 2014-03-11 House Passed/Adopted passage
  • 2014-03-26 Senate Sent to Governor executive-receipt
  • 2014-04-14 Senate Date Signed by Governor executive-signature
  • 2014-04-14 Act 480 executive-signature
  • 2014-07-01 Effective Date
